Braxton Cook

Braxton Cook is an Emmy Award Winning Artist and one of this generation’s most exciting emerging voices in the Jazz world. Braxton grew up in Silver Spring, Maryland. ANAVITÓRIA

ANAVITÓRIA is a Brazilian folk-pop duo consisting of singer-songwriter Ana Caetano and singer Vitória Falcão. One of the most-streamed artists in Brazil, ANAVITÓRIA have released two albums so far, both nominated for ‘Best Portuguese Language Contemporary Pop Album’ at the Latin Grammy Awards in 2017 and 2019. Drax Project

Drax Project are Shaan Singh (lead vocals, sax, keys), Matt Beachen (drums), Sam Thomson (bass, keys, BVs) and Ben O’Leary (Guitar, keys, BVs).
